摘要
以生长3-4d的玉米(ZeamaysL.)根尖为材料,用两相法得到高纯度的质膜,鉴定了质膜上存在一受钙激活的蛋白激酶。该类激酶主要位于质膜内侧;钙的半激活浓度为50μmol/L;外源钙调素对激酶没有明显的活化作用;钙调素拮抗剂三氟拉嗪(TFP)可明显抑制激酶活性,半抑制浓度为75μmol/L;该类激酶对外源底物组蛋白ⅢS型有较高的特异性。结果显示此激酶属于钙依赖钙调素不依赖蛋白激酶。质膜上33kD和58kD两种蛋白可能是这种钙依赖蛋白激酶的内源底物。
Plasma membrane (PM) of high purity was prepared through a two-phase aqueous system from rootsof 3-4 d old corn (Zea mays L. ) seedling, and within which calcium-activated protein kinase was identified. The kinase was mainly located in the inner side of the PM with a semi-activation concentration to freecalcium ion of 50 μmol/L. Exogenous CaM had no agonistic effect on the protein kinase but CaM antagonistTFP could strongly inhibit its activity with a semi-inhibition concentration of 75 μmol/L. The protein kinaseshowed high specificity for the exogenous substrate, Histone ⅢS. These results indicated that this protein kinase could be a calcium-dependent and calmodulin-independent protein kinase (CDPK). Moreover, two pro teins (33 kD and 58 kD) in PM might be the endogenous substrates of the CDPK.
